HRH Princess Lalla Hasnaa Chairs in Rabat Inauguration of National Finery Museum

Rabat, 07/01/2023 (MAP) – Her Royal Highness Princess Lalla Hasnaa, President of the Foundation for the Safeguarding of the Cultural Heritage of Rabat, presided, Saturday at the Kasbah of Oudayas, over the inauguration of the National Finery Museum.

After cutting the ribbon, Her Royal Highness visited the various rooms of the National Finery Museum, accompanied by the Commissioner of the exhibition, Abdelaziz Idrissi, and the Curator of the National Finery Museum, Fatima-Zahra Khlifi.

It is Room I « The historical development of the finery and the chain of manufacture », Room II « The history of Moroccan costume », Room III « The male finery and harness », Room IV « The Amazigh finery » and Room V « The regional specificities of the main production centers of urban jewelry ».

Her Royal Highness Princess Lalla Hasnaa then visited the temporary exhibition room of the Museum where the works of three Moroccan creators, namely Tamy Tazi, Zhor Raïs and Albert Oiknine, are showcased.

At the end of this ceremony, the book of the 10 years of the National Museums Foundation (FNM) was handed over to Her Royal Highness by the president of the Foundation, Mehdi Qotbi.

Upon her arrival, HRH Princess Lalla Hasnaa reviewed a section of the auxiliary forces that made the honors, before being greeted by the Minister of Tourism, Handicrafts and Social Economy, Fatima Zahra Ammor, the Minister of Youth, Culture and Communication, Mohammed Mehdi Bensaid and the Wali of the Rabat-Salé-Kenitra region, Mohamed Yacoubi.

Her Royal Highness was also greeted by the President of the Regional Council, Rachid El Abdi, the President of the City Council of Rabat, Asmaa Rhlalou, the President of the Prefectural Council of Rabat, Abdelaziz Derouiche, the President of the Council of the Hassan district, Idriss Errazi, the general manager of the Rabat Region Development Company, Mohamed Belbachir, the president of the National Museums Foundation (FNM), Mehdi Qotbi, the director of the Mohammed VI Museum of Modern and Contemporary Art and curator of the exhibition, Abdelaziz El Idrissi, and the FNM Steering Committee.
